Output 72abbd8369e20968904b1731e0b6fccb06ba4213d0ad9ea569bb3584aaba8598:1

value
77476
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3044881b121c3407c9d36234bb7d6461d5207c72 OP_EQUALVERIFY OP_CHECKSIG
address
15QDXsY1fWHKvALRkKXup8z45j9y5TAyt4
transaction
72abbd8369e20968904b1731e0b6fccb06ba4213d0ad9ea569bb3584aaba8598
confirmations
512729
spent
true